AMPLIFISH

FISH image analysis for oncogene amplification typing (ecDNA vs HSR).

AMPLIFISH turns multi-channel FISH microscopy images into per-nucleus feature tables — target/centromere spot counts, nucleus shape, and the Shannon entropy of the target-spot spatial distribution — that separate ecDNA (extrachromosomal DNA) from HSR (homogeneously staining regions). The pipeline is unsupervised: no labelled training data or fine-tuning required.

Installation

git clone https://github.com/akdemirlab/AMPLIFISH.git
cd AMPLIFISH
conda create -n amplifish python=3.9 -y && conda activate amplifish
pip install -e .

Dependencies (including the CellposeSAM segmentation backend) install automatically. See docs/installation.md for system requirements and details.

Demo

cd demo && bash demo.sh        # or: python run_demo.py --cpu

Runs the full pipeline on two bundled Colo320 FISH images (1 ecDNA + 1 HSR) and writes per-nucleus feature tables plus a figure separating the two amplification types. See docs/demo.md for expected output and run time.
